Synthesis and photophysics of a porphyrin-fullerene dyad assembled through Watson-Crick hydrogen bonding.

Jonathan L Sessler1, Janarthanan Jayawickramarajah, Andreas Gouloumis, Tomas Torres, Dirk M Guldi, Stephen Maldonado, Keith J Stevenson.   

Abstract

A novel porphyrin-fullerene dyad assembled through Watson-Crick hydrogen bonds is described; this system undergoes photoinduced electron transfer upon irradiation with visible light to produce a charge separated state that is substantially longer lived than that of previous dyads of this type.
